So, 'FaLaLaLaLa' is an interesting piece from the 2018 Creepy Christmas Film Festival by Glass Eye Pix. It revolves around this eerie concept inspired by a wreath. The atmosphere is thick with tension, playing on the juxtaposition of holiday cheer and horror. The pacing is tight, making those short moments of stillness all the more unsettling. There’s something about the practical effects here—raw, gritty, and effective, they really ground the surreal elements. The performances are quite striking, each actor brings a unique energy that adds to the overall creepiness. It’s distinct in how it merges classic holiday imagery with horror, a neat little exploration of the darker sides of festivity. Definitely one for those who appreciate the genre's quirks.
